Features

  • Fast Switching Speed
  • Surface Mount Package Ideally Suited for Automated Insertion
  • For General Purpose Switching Applications
  • High Conductance
  • Lead, Halogen and Antimony Free, RoHS Compliant “Green” Device (Notes 1 and 2)
  • Qualified to AEC-Q101 Standards for High Reliability Mechanical Data
  • Case: SOT23
  • Case Material: Molded Plastic. UL Flammability Classification Rating 94V-0
  • Moisture Sensitivity: Level 1 per J-STD-020
  • Terminals: Solderable per MIL-STD-202, Method 208
  • Lead Free Plating (Matte Tin Finish annealed over Alloy 42 leadframe).
  • Polarity: See Diagram
